## Auth

Poolster manages connections to the Quartzline replica set. Pool size is capped at 20 per worker; idle connections recycle after 90s. Credentials are injected at boot — never hardcoded. Reviewers: verify no raw DSNs appear in diffs. Local runs authenticate against the Fennwick staging proxy with the following key.

service key, yadug-bajog: zpat3_pou

Facilities ticket — Halewick Tower, night shift.

Issue: support team reporting east stairwell reader rejecting badges after midnight. Reader was reset this morning; firmware updated. Overnight crew should now badge as normal. If the reader fails again, use the manual keypad by the fire door — do not prop the door. Log any further failures with the time and badge name. Temporary keypad code for the fallback door is below.

door code, tajeg-fawip: bdg-K-62

## Further Reading

Cold starts in the Brindlegate serverless runtime are dominated by dependency resolution, not container scheduling, so our handlers pre-bake a warmed snapshot at deploy time. New team members should understand the snapshot lifecycle before touching the init path: a stale snapshot silently falls back to a full cold boot, which is why p99 latency occasionally spikes after releases. The complete explanation, with tracing examples and tuning guidance, lives on the internal engineering page linked here.

runbook for kahog-tafop: https://confluence.zemvarsys.internal/projects/pages/browse/browse/91a2